Snowflake (SNOW) Shares Tumble 15% on Conservative Guidance, Analysts Worried About 'Consumption Unknowns'
May 26, 2022 6:47 AM EDTShares of Snowflake (NYSE: SNOW) are down more than 15% in premarket trading Thursday after the cloud-based data warehousing company reported its Q1 results.
SNOW reported a loss per share of 53c in Q1, compared to a loss per share of 70c in the year-ago period. The company reported $422.4 million in revenue, up 85% YoY, and above the analyst consensus of $413.9 million.
